Do you know the history behind our billy barr? Long before weather apps and online snow reports, billy barr was recording Crested Butte’s winters by hand from his remote cabin in Gothic. Arriving in the 1970s, billy became known for meticulously tracking snowfall, temperatures, and wildlife observations year after year. His decades of data transformed a personal passion into an invaluable scientific record, helping researchers better understand climate and ecological change in the Rocky Mountains.
Today, his legacy lives on through the Rocky Mountain Biological Laboratory (RMBL), where science, curiosity, and a deep connection to the natural world continue to inspire discovery.
